Emergency Call Features

When choosing a smartwatch for elderly safety, focus on emergency call features. Quick access can save a life. Look for watches with a special emergency button or one-touch features. These let you call help fast by contacting pre-set numbers right away. Some watches have GPS. This shows your location during a call, so help can find you easily.

Other watches can automatically call for help if they detect a fall or strange movement. This gives extra safety without needing to press anything. Make sure the emergency features work well and are easy to turn on. A broken emergency button will not help when you really need it.

Test the emergency options before using the watch daily. Pick a smartwatch with simple, clear steps to activate emergency help. This way, help is just a press away when you need it most.

Water and Dust Resistance

A smartwatch’s strength depends on how well it handles water and dirt. These watches have ratings called IP ratings. A higher IP number means better protection. For example, an IP68 watches can be dipped in water up to 1.5 meters deep for 30 minutes. That’s good for when it gets splashed or rained on. If you’re active, choose a watch with at least 5ATM water resistance. This can handle sweating, swimming, or taking a shower. Dust can get into the watch and cause problems. Dust-proof watches keep out dirt, sweat, and sand. They stay clean longer and work better. When picking a watch, check its ratings. Make sure the ratings match your loved one’s daily use. This way, the watch stays safe and works well.

Battery Life and Longevity

When you want to keep your loved one safe, battery life matters a lot. A smartwatch that lasts 5-7 days on a single charge means fewer worries. It can do things like track GPS and monitor health without needing to be charged often. Most smartwatches use lithium-ion batteries. These batteries usually stay good for about 1-2 years before you need a new one. The size of the battery, measured in mAh, tells you how much power it can hold. Bigger batteries store more power and last longer between charges. Features like checking the heartbeat all the time or sending emergency alerts use more battery. So, pick a watch with good battery life to make sure it works when you need it most. The key is to choose a watch that holds a charge longer, so safety always stays on.
